This portrait print showcases Etienne Jacques Joseph Alexandre MacDonald, the 1st Duke of Taranto (1765-1840), painted by Antoine Jean Gros, Baron (1771-1835). The artist skillfully captures the essence of this distinguished marshal of France, known for his remarkable military career and contributions to French history. In this neoclassical masterpiece, MacDonald's commanding presence is evident as he gazes confidently into the distance. His strong features are accentuated by subtle brushstrokes that highlight his noble character and unwavering determination. The use of oil on wood adds depth and richness to the painting, enhancing its timeless appeal. Displayed in the Musee de l'Histoire de France at Chateau de Versailles, this fine art piece serves as a testament to both MacDonald's legacy and Gros' artistic prowess.
